Apogee Therapeutics (NASDAQ:APGE) Insider Carl Dambkowski Sells 5,500 Shares

Apogee Therapeutics Inc. (NASDAQ:APGEGet Free Report) insider Carl Dambkowski sold 5,500 shares of Apogee Therapeutics st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, March 4th. The shares were sold at an average price of $71.06, for a total value of $390,830.00. Following the completion of the sale, the insider owned 209,773 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$14,906,469.38. The trade was a 2.55% decrease in their ownership of the stock. Apogee Therapeutics Company Profile

Apogee Therapeutics, Inc is a clinical-stage biotechnology company dedicated to the discovery and development of novel small molecule therapeutics that selectively target the nuclear receptor RORγt, a master regulator of T cell-driven inflammatory pathways. By modulating RORγt activity, Apogee aims to offer an oral treatment option for patients with autoimmune and inflammatory skin disorders.

The company’s lead candidate, APG-157, is an oral RORγt inverse agonist currently undergoing early-stage clinical evaluation for moderate to severe plaque psoriasis.
